Add 40/72 and 9/6
1st number: 40/72, 2nd number: 1 3/6
40/72 + 9/6 is 37/18.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 72 and 6 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 72 × 1 = 72,
40/72 = 40 × 1/72 × 1 = 40/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 6 × 12 = 72,
9/6 = 9 × 12/6 × 12 = 108/72 - Add the two like fractions:
40/72 + 108/72 = 40 + 108/72 = 148/72 - 148/72 simplified gives 37/18
- So, 40/72 + 9/6 = 37/18
